Last change
on this file since ef9ee0e was
40cfbc5,
checked in by dequis <dx@…>, at 2015-04-28T13:47:48Z
|
hipchat: Basic implementation: Auth, profile and mention names
This is enough to log in with their usernames, make 'chat add' based
groupchat joins slightly more smooth, and see mention names as nicks.
All the MUC list stuff is left out intentionally since that's not as
stable as I wish.
|
-
Property mode set to
100644
|
File size:
868 bytes
|
Line | |
---|
1 | ########################### |
---|
2 | ## Makefile for BitlBee ## |
---|
3 | ## ## |
---|
4 | ## Copyright 2002 Lintux ## |
---|
5 | ########################### |
---|
6 | |
---|
7 | ### DEFINITIONS |
---|
8 | |
---|
9 | -include ../../Makefile.settings |
---|
10 | ifdef _SRCDIR_ |
---|
11 | _SRCDIR_ := $(_SRCDIR_)protocols/jabber/ |
---|
12 | endif |
---|
13 | |
---|
14 | # [SH] Program variables |
---|
15 | objects = conference.o io.o iq.o jabber.o jabber_util.o message.o presence.o s5bytestream.o sasl.o si.o hipchat.o |
---|
16 | |
---|
17 | LFLAGS += -r |
---|
18 | |
---|
19 | # [SH] Phony targets |
---|
20 | all: jabber_mod.o |
---|
21 | check: all |
---|
22 | lcov: check |
---|
23 | gcov: |
---|
24 | gcov *.c |
---|
25 | |
---|
26 | .PHONY: all clean distclean |
---|
27 | |
---|
28 | clean: |
---|
29 | rm -f *.o core |
---|
30 | |
---|
31 | distclean: clean |
---|
32 | rm -rf .depend |
---|
33 | |
---|
34 | ### MAIN PROGRAM |
---|
35 | |
---|
36 | $(objects): ../../Makefile.settings Makefile |
---|
37 | |
---|
38 | $(objects): %.o: $(_SRCDIR_)%.c |
---|
39 | @echo '*' Compiling $< |
---|
40 | @$(CC) -c $(CFLAGS) $(CFLAGS_BITLBEE) $< -o $@ |
---|
41 | |
---|
42 | jabber_mod.o: $(objects) |
---|
43 | @echo '*' Linking jabber_mod.o |
---|
44 | @$(LD) $(LFLAGS) $(objects) -o jabber_mod.o |
---|
45 | |
---|
46 | -include .depend/*.d |
---|
Note: See
TracBrowser
for help on using the repository browser.